A chief and residential school survivor says he will be looking for justice and healing when he leads the Assembly of First Nations delegation to meet with Pope Francis next month at the Vatican.

“We do this to seek true reconciliation,” Norman Yakeleya, Assembly of First Nations regional chief for the Northwest Territories, said Thursday.On Thursday, the AFN announced 13 delegates, including Yakeleya, will be going to the Vatican from Dec. 14 to 21. Those chosen represent First Nations across the country and include residential school survivors and two youth delegates.

The group will have a one-hour meeting with the Pope on Dec. 20 when they expect to talk about different themes including the 10 principles of reconciliation and unmarked graves at the sites of former residential schools. He said the group will ask Pope Francis to deliver an apology for the Catholic Church's role in residential schools. But, he said, the discussion must go further because “it's also important to think about what happens in a post-apology world.”Over a century, an estimated 150,000 Indigenous children were forced to attend residential schools. More than 60 per cent of the schools were run by the Catholic Church.

The delegation's theme is how Indigenous Peoples and the Catholic Church can come together toward healing and reconciliation.Former AFN national chief Phil Fontaine from Sagkeeng First Nation in Manitoba said he hopes Pope Francis will commit to an apology in Canada during the delegation's visit to Rome.
